Job Description:
Overview Partner with the SVP Enterprise Risk in developing,
managing, and promoting overall operational risk management
standards and framework. Lead and drive the strategic and
operational direction in implementing/enhancing an operational risk
program. The Operational Risk Management (ORM) program is
responsible for supporting the achievement of Navy Federal's
objectives by addressing the full spectrum of its operational
risks. Responsibilities Develop and implement comprehensive
operational risk management strategies aligned with the company's
objectives and regulatory requirements
Provide strategic direction into the development and enhancement of
ORM Policy, Standards, and Procedures, ensuring accuracy,
consistency, simplicity, and effectiveness
Engage and partner with Business Units to influence adoption of ORM
frameworks, policies, standards, and procedures
Identify, assess, and prioritize operational risks across all
business units and functions
Counsel and advise key stakeholders on complex risk issues; provide
guidance and feedback to business units throughout their risk
management lifecycle
Engage with senior stakeholders and provide challenge where
appropriate
Oversee the implementation of risk mitigation plans, controls, and
processes to minimize operational risk exposure
Establish key risk indicators (KRIs) and metrics to monitor and
report on operational risk levels and trends
Lead cross-functional teams and collaborate with control partners
to achieve objectives across multiple business units
Participate in and support internal and external audits, regulatory
reviews, and rating agency requests
Collaborate with senior leadership and department heads to embed a
strong risk culture throughout the organization
Lead the operational risk assessment process, including scenario
analysis, to evaluate potential impacts on business operations
Provide guidance and support to business units in identifying,
assessing, and managing operational risks within their respective
areas
Stay abreast of industry best practices, regulatory changes, and
emerging risks to continuously enhance the operational risk
management framework
Conduct periodic reviews and assessments of existing risk
management policies, procedures, and frameworks to ensure
effectiveness and alignment with evolving business needs
Serve as a subject matter expert on operational risk management
matters, providing advice and recommendations to senior management
and stakeholders
Oversee quality and on-time preparation of senior management and
Board-level committee materials
Oversee the operational risk issues and events management
program
